Output e126e5703427e85aa697837215c5cefb0f12782af6aec1a494bdb87582e177bf:628

value
20743
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 391f3bbe17b4d5c05b8ab943bf020faa329c860e1e1d46f471c1943ba52fe56c
address
bc1p8y0nh0shkn2uqku2h9pm7qs04gefepswrcw5dar3cx2rhff0u4kqe3nfq7
transaction
e126e5703427e85aa697837215c5cefb0f12782af6aec1a494bdb87582e177bf
spent
true